Interstate Fire
On Friday afternoon around 4:21 p.m. the Fayette County Sheriff’s Office received a 911 call reporting 18 Wheeler truck on fire on Interstate 10 eastbound at the 663 mile marker. The Flatonia Fire Department was notified and responded to the scene. Flatonia P.D. Officers Trey Tunis and Taylor Amos also responded to the fire along with Deputies Herman Olvera and Cedar Chase. Upon arrival it was reported the truck was fully engulfed in fire. Assistance from the Schulenburg Fire Department was requested and they responded to the scene. The fire was extinguished and there were no reported Injuries. The trailer contained food items and it is believed the fire originated from the engine area.
